File relating to the history and development of banking in Jersey. Includes a copy of the Code of 1771 (Amendment) (Jersey) Law 1962, an extract from John Jean's Jersey Sailing Ships, an article from the Jersey Evening Post on banking during the occupation, bank deposit figures and graphical representations, figures for type of bank, information from Balleine's History of Jersey, a section from Anstead's The Channel Islands, and figures concerning the growth in banks and bank deposits
